No-Bake Lemon Blueberry Éclair Cake

A bright and creamy dessert that combines the flavors of lemon and blueberry in a no-bake éclair cake.

Ingredients

Scale
  • 250g tea biscuits (like Petit Beurre or graham crackers)
  • 250g cream cheese, softened
  • 200ml heavy cream, whipped
  • 1 can (400g) sweetened condensed milk
  • 1 cup lemon curd
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ract
  • 1 1/2 cups blueberry compote or pie filling
  • Fresh lemon slices and blueberries for topping

Instructions

  1. In a large bowl, beat cream cheese until smooth. Add condensed milk, lemon curd, and vanilla. Fold in whipped cream gently until silky and light.
  2. In a rectangular dish, arrange a layer of biscuits. Spread half of the lemon cream, then a layer of blueberry filling. Add another layer of biscuits, remaining cream, and smooth the top.
  3. Refrigerate at least 4 hours, or overnight for best texture.
  4. Top with lemon slices and fresh blueberries before serving.

Notes

  • Use frozen blueberries simmered with sugar and lemon juice for homemade compote.
  • Add a drizzle of melted white chocolate for elegance.
  • Serve chilled for clean slices.
